Condividi tramite


ArmKeyVaultModelFactory.KeyVaultNetworkRuleSet Method

Definition

A set of rules governing the network accessibility of a vault.

public static Azure.ResourceManager.KeyVault.Models.KeyVaultNetworkRuleSet KeyVaultNetworkRuleSet(Azure.ResourceManager.KeyVault.Models.KeyVaultNetworkRuleBypassOption? bypass = default, Azure.ResourceManager.KeyVault.Models.KeyVaultNetworkRuleAction? defaultAction =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.KeyVault.Models.KeyVaultIPRule> ipRules =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.KeyVault.Models.KeyVaultVirtualNetworkRule> virtualNetworkRules = default);
static member KeyVaultNetworkRuleSet : Nullable<Azure.ResourceManager.KeyVault.Models.KeyVaultNetworkRuleBypassOption> * Nullable<Azure.ResourceManager.KeyVault.Models.KeyVaultNetworkRuleAction> * seq<Azure.ResourceManager.KeyVault.Models.KeyVaultIPRule> * seq<Azure.ResourceManager.KeyVault.Models.KeyVaultVirtualNetworkRule> -> Azure.ResourceManager.KeyVault.Models.KeyVaultNetworkRuleSet
Public Shared Function KeyVaultNetworkRuleSet (Optional bypass As Nullable(Of KeyVaultNetworkRuleBypassOption) = Nothing, Optional defaultAction As Nullable(Of KeyVaultNetworkRuleAction) = Nothing, Optional ipRules As IEnumerable(Of KeyVaultIPRule) = Nothing, Optional virtualNetworkRules As IEnumerable(Of KeyVaultVirtualNetworkRule) = Nothing) As KeyVaultNetworkRuleSet

Parameters

bypass
Nullable<KeyVaultNetworkRuleBypassOption>

Tells what traffic can bypass network rules. This can be 'AzureServices' or 'None'. If not specified the default is 'AzureServices'.

defaultAction
Nullable<KeyVaultNetworkRuleAction>

The default action when no rule from ipRules and from virtualNetworkRules match. This is only used after the bypass property has been evaluated.

ipRules
IEnumerable<KeyVaultIPRule>

The list of IP address rules.

virtualNetworkRules
IEnumerable<KeyVaultVirtualNetworkRule>

The list of virtual network rules.

Returns

A new KeyVaultNetworkRuleSet instance for mocking.

Applies to